Having pillaged the U.S. as the offensive Kazakh journalist Borat, actor Sacha Baron Cohen is now ready to break America’s collective anoos – as Br¼no.
Br¼no, a long-running Cohen alter ego, plagued unwitting interviewees on Da Ali G Show. Br¼no was a flamboyantly gay Austrian TV reporter, whose schtick is well-enscapsulated by one reported title for his forthcoming feature: Br¼no: Delicious Journeys Through America for the Purpose of Making Heterosexual Males Visibly Uncomfortable in the Presence of a Gay Foreigner in a Mesh T-Shirt.
Variety reports Bruno will be financed by Media Rights Capital, backers of Babel and the soon-to-be-released remake of Sleuth.
